How can PSA software support SaaS implementation and delivery teams?

Delivering SaaS projects successfully depends on how well different teams work together. Sales, implementation, customer success, and finance all play a part in turning a new client into a satisfied, long-term partner. The real challenge is keeping everyone aligned while managing timelines, budgets, and client expectations. This is where PSA software becomes a real advantage.

From my experience, PSA systems bring structure, visibility, and control to what can often feel like a fast-moving and unpredictable process. Here is how they support SaaS implementation and delivery teams at every stage.

1. Centralizing project and resource planning

In many SaaS organizations, projects start quickly after a deal is signed, but coordination between sales and delivery is not always seamless. PSA software creates one shared environment where timelines, deliverables, and resource availability are visible to everyone.

For example, when a SaaS company begins a new implementation, project managers can review capacity, assign consultants, and confirm delivery dates based on real data. In Birdview PSA, resource planning tools show utilization in real time, helping teams balance workloads and prevent overbooking key specialists.

2. Automating onboarding and setup workflows

The first impression during onboarding often shapes the entire client relationship. Manual coordination through spreadsheets and emails can lead to delays and missed steps.

Birdview PSA simplifies this by automating onboarding with templates, approval workflows, and progress tracking. Each client follows a consistent and well-documented process that covers setup, configuration, and training. This keeps delivery professional and predictable.

For instance, if a SaaS provider needs to assign an account manager, configure integrations, and schedule client workshops, Birdview automatically creates and tracks these tasks without requiring manual follow-up.

3. Tracking time, costs, and utilization

Accurate time tracking and cost control are essential for profitable delivery. Without clear data, teams risk underestimating workloads or losing visibility into budgets. PSA software connects project activities with financials, giving managers real-time insight into profitability.

In Birdview PSA, every task, hour, and expense is linked to the corresponding project. Managers can compare planned versus actual effort, monitor margins, and make timely adjustments. If an implementation starts to exceed its budget, Birdview highlights the issue early so teams can take corrective action.

4. Improving collaboration and communication

Effective collaboration is the foundation of smooth SaaS delivery. Instead of relying on long email chains, PSA software provides a central space for updates, discussions, and approvals.

Birdview PSA includes a client portal where customers can log in to view progress, track milestones, and approve deliverables. Internally, teams can exchange comments, upload files, and keep all communication tied directly to project tasks. This shared visibility reduces misunderstandings and builds client confidence.

When clients can access real-time updates, conversations become more productive and focused on next steps rather than status checks.

5. Streamlining reporting and performance analysis

Once a project goes live, delivery teams need to monitor performance and learn from results. PSA platforms consolidate all relevant data into dashboards that track utilization, project health, and client satisfaction.

Birdview PSA includes built-in BI dashboards with over 300 preconfigured reports. Managers can compare planned versus actual timelines and costs, identify improvement areas, and share insights with leadership or clients.

For example, if one team consistently finishes implementations faster, managers can analyze their workflow and apply those best practices across the organization.

6. Supporting scalability as the business grows

Manual processes can work for a few clients but quickly become unsustainable as the business expands. PSA systems allow SaaS companies to scale operations without sacrificing quality.

With Birdview PSA, teams can manage multiple client projects simultaneously while keeping processes standardized and efficient. Templates, workflows, and reporting tools ensure that every new client receives the same high-quality experience, no matter how large the portfolio becomes.

For SaaS companies, PSA software is more than an administrative tool. It is the foundation for efficient, transparent, and scalable delivery. By centralizing planning, automating workflows, improving collaboration, and monitoring performance, PSA systems help teams stay organized and clients stay confident.
